Police appeal to locate teenager missing from Maroubra

Police are appealing for public assistance to locate a teenage girl missing from Sydney's east.

Olivia Avauena-Sorrensen, aged 15, was last seen at her home on New Orleans Crescent, Maroubra, about 11.30am on Saturday (23 September 2023).

When she could not be located or contacted, officers attached to Eastern Beaches Police Area Command were notified and commenced inquiries into her whereabouts.

Police and family hold concerns for her welfare due to her age.

Olivia is described as being of Caucasian appearance, about 155cm tall, of a medium build, with long brown hair and brown eyes.

She was last seen wearing a black hooded jumper, black tracksuit pants, black sneakers, a black beanie, and a black shoulder bag.

She may be traveling on the train network, and is known to frequent to Eastern Beaches, Sydney CBD, Inner West and Bankstown areas.

Anyone with information into her whereabouts is urged to call police or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000.
